77. Deputy Jim Daly asked the Tánaiste and Minister for Justice and Equality if a use it or lose it by year end rule is or has been in operation within her Department when devolving funding to agencies under her remit on an annual basis;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[29200/16]

View answer

Written answers

The Department does not have a defined rule in relation to this matter. Rather, the funding to agencies, under the remit of the Department, is provided through the annual estimates process and is subject to the standard Government accounting arrangements which provides for the surrender to the exchequer of unspent monies at year end. However, through prudent use of resources and using the mechanisms available such as the capital carryover provisions, where appropriate, and virement, the Department ensures that the best possible value and effectiveness is derived from all funding within the context of the rules of Government accounting.
